Report: Star Conte is said to want at Spurs has ‘verbal agreement’ to join Serie A club

Fabrizio Romano has revealed that rumoured Tottenham target Andre Onana has a verbal agreement to join Inter Milan at the end of the season.

With Hugo Lloris now into the final year of his contract at Tottenham, it has been reported that the club are on the lookout for the Frenchman’s successor. 

90 min reported two weeks ago that Tottenham could move for Onana, whose contract at Ajax runs out at the end of the season.

The report suggested that Antonio Conte has been an admirer of the Cameroon international for a long time and has informed Fabio Paratici of his desire to have him in North London.

It was also asserted that the 25-year-old had decided not to extend his stay at the Johan Cruyff Arena.

While Romano has now backed up the claim regarding Onana’s decision to leave Ajax at the end of the season, the journalist revealed that the goalkeeper seems to be on his way to Inter.

He explained that although Onana has not signed a pre-contract agreement with the Nerrazuri, he has verbally agreed to join the club as a free agent at the end of the season.

Romano later reported that Onana had confirmed his impending exit from Ajax:
